How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Jonesborough?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Jonesborough Pet Friendly 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,347 | $825 | $2,375 |
| Jonesborough Pet Friendly 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,505 | $875 | $2,840 |
| Jonesborough Pet Friendly 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,880 | $1,237 | $3,320 |
| Jonesborough Pet Friendly 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,787 | $700 | $2,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Jonesborough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Jonesborough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Jonesborough is $1,437.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Jonesborough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Jonesborough is a 1,751 square feet unit starting from $1,399 at The Henry on Main.
What is the average size for Jonesborough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Jonesborough is currently at 701 sq ft.
